**Overview** : The Business Value Architect supports our most complex, strategic, transformational multi-million dollar pursuits. They think big, out of the box and help shape multi-tower transformations by engaging early and bringing the power of one-NTT to our clients. They help transform, reimagine and reinvent client’s businesses leveraging technology and our services.
The Business Value Architect will focus on helping our clients realize business value and achieve their objectives through technology-led business transformation. They will engage directly with CxOs and business leaders to align industry and business priorities with transformational initiatives. As a subject matter expert in a specific industry - such as Banking, Insurance, Manufacturing, Supply Chain, Commercial Industries, Health Plans, Providers, Life Sciences, or the Public Sector - they will leverage both internal and external research to uncover customer strategies, visions, priorities, challenges, and headwinds, and help define technology-led business transformation using NTT DATA services. They will lead vision, transformation, and value assessment consulting sessions with clients, producing points of view, transformation hypotheses, value cases, and business cases through in-depth value chain analysis. The Business Value Architect will collaborate with multidisciplinary pursuit teams and utilize a consultative approach to articulate clear, business-centric problem statements and ensure alignment throughout the engagement.
Responsibilities:
+ Conduct thorough research to gain a deep understanding of the client’s business strategy, vision, and objectives.
+ Analyse the client’s business processes and key performance indicators (KPIs) to identify areas for improvement.
+ Assess industry and client-specific trends, headwinds, pain points, value chains, and growth opportunities.
+ Formulate “Art of the Possible” transformation hypotheses, develop C-suite engagement strategies, executive narratives, and prepare robust investment justifications, value cases, and business cases.
+ Build and maintain a reusable library of repeatable assets, models, and frameworks
+ Serve as a trusted advisor to both internal teams and client business leaders
+ Leverage a consultative approach to deliver compelling business cases and value propositions, clearly articulating the benefits of business and technology modernization and transformation
+ Work collaboratively across multi-solution and cross-functional teams including Sales, Client Executives, Consulting Engagement Leads, Solution/Enterprise Architects, Client Delivery, and Operations to ensure alignment of proposed solutions with customer business objectives and goals
+ Clearly and persuasively communicate business solutions to clients and stakeholders, ensuring alignment and buy-in at all levels
**Qualifications**
+ 12 years of experience in a management consulting or value engineering or sales operations from a top-tier consulting firm or large IT services provider (or a similar role)
+ 7 years of experience applying methodologies and strategic business analysis to assess financial, strategic, and operational benefits, leveraging these insights to develop value propositions, business cases, and ROI justifications
+ Familiar with technology modernization and transformation concepts, methodologies, and frameworks
+ Experience working in one or more of the following industries: Banking, Financial Services, Insurance; Manufacturing, Commercial, or Healthcare industries
+ Bachelor's degree in business, finance, engineering, or a related field
**Preferred Qualifications:**
+ Relevant certifications in business value analysis (e.g., CBVAL, Certified ROI Professional) highly preferred
+ MBA (preferred) or equivalent advanced business degree
